Loops: for, while, do while, for...of e for...in

Loops: for, while, do while, for...of e for...in

Loops são estruturas fundamentais que permitem executar um bloco de código repetidamente enquanto uma condição específica for verdadeira. Em JavaScript, existem cinco tipos principais de loops: for, while, do...while, for...of e for...in. Cada um possui características únicas que os tornam mais adequados para diferentes cenários.

Notícias

Todos Recentes Tendências
Lifetimes em structs e impl

Rust

Lifetimes em structs e impl

Em Rust, toda referência possui um lifetime — o período durante o qual ela é válida. Quando tentamos armazenar uma referência em uma struct sem anotar o lifetime, o compilador não consegue verificar se a referência ainda será válida quando a struct for usada. Considere o exemplo:

05/05/2026

Revista

Ver todos
Leitura e escrita de arquivos texto

Linguagem C

Leitura e escrita de arquivos texto

Arquivos texto são arquivos que armazenam dados legíveis por humanos, organizados em linhas separadas pelo caractere de nova linha (\n). Diferentemente dos arquivos binários, que armazenam dados em formato bruto (bytes sem interpretação), os arquivos texto podem ser abertos e visualizados em qualquer editor de texto simples. A terminação de linha varia entre sistemas operacionais: \n no Linux/macOS, \r\n no Windows, mas a biblioteca padrão do C trata essa diferença automaticamente no modo texto.